Hi, I go by the nickname "Jay".  I’m a retired Air Force Master Sergeant now living in Springfield, Missouri.  My first car when I was 17 years old was a 1970 Monte Carlo.  I’ve wanted another one for a long time and finally made the move on one this summer.  It’s a 1970 with a 383 stroker engine and a 700R4 transmission.  It was restored with many custom touches, but it retains the classic look and feel that I love.  I’ve always enjoyed going to car shows as a spectator, and now I get to participate in them!  I get lots of compliments and enjoy the car more every day.  Happy to be a member of FGMCC to share info and photos with other Monte Carlo lovers.

Welcome to the club and forums, Jay!  Your '70 is a classic beauty and the exterior color combo is somewhat familiar.  I owned an Autumn Gold and Black vinyl top '70 SS454 for eight years and always loved that color.  My first new car out of college was an Autumn Gold '70 with a white vinyl top.  Looks like your '70 has an upgraded drivetrain and some other tasteful, well-executed mods to add to your enjoyment.  Well done!
